The St. Francois Mts. are older than the Ozarks, Rockies, Smokies,etc, supposedly I have 500 million year old rocks. This area was mined since the 1700's, the first lead mine in the nation was Mine La Motte. We had Silver, Gold, Copper, Cobalt, Lead, etc all mined here.
